Ghana vs Panama
Ghana won it at the very last minute, beating Panama 1-0 with a Caleb Yirenkyi goal in a tense game in Toronto.
How the match went
This was a tight, low-scoring game that both teams badly wanted to win.
Chances were rare, and both defenses were hard to break down.
Half-time came with the score still 0-0, and the tension kept building.
Panama defended well and stayed organized, and they looked like they might earn a point.
Ghana kept pushing, sure their talent would find a way through.
Then, right at the end, Caleb Yirenkyi scored in the 90+5th minute to make it 1-0.
It was a dramatic late winner, and the relief for Ghana was huge.
Panama came so close to a point, but Ghana had a bit more quality and took the win.

What's next for Ghana?
Ghana play England on June 23, and that is a big step up.
England just beat Croatia 4-2, so they arrive full of confidence.
After grabbing a late win here, Ghana will need their very best to take anything from that game.
What's next for Panama?
Panama play Croatia on June 23, and they will be desperate to bounce back.
Croatia just lost 4-2 to England, so they are far from unbeatable.
After coming so close against Ghana, Panama will believe they can get their first points here.
